TEHRAN – Tehran’s Arteh Gallery hosted an Iranian group, which held a performance art program on Friday based on two short stories from American author Charles Bukowski’s collection “Hot Water Music”.
Mehrdad Mostafavi, Vida Tayyebati, Sina Zeinali and Amir-Hossein Fardi are the members of the group, which was directed Milad Shajareh, the gallery announced in a press release on Friday.
The 30-minute performance will be repeated until August 8 at the gallery located on Molla Sadra St., Vanak Square.
“Hot Water Music” was published in 1983. It is an important collection that establishes Bukowski's minimalist style and his thematic oeuvre.
